Output 2e80677da8e271f61309d69723835011e2530da5ae3745b1ed4c3268b1e78768:7

value
106464514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623ab9b9d1a156624e036554bacfa16a3a07a26a OP_EQUAL
address
MGrYoYkbiMsXQuKRsA6ghCu74cgKftqZoW
transaction
2e80677da8e271f61309d69723835011e2530da5ae3745b1ed4c3268b1e78768
spent
true